Dwell Touch and hold the item on the screen to open the context
menu.
Flick
Move a finger quickly in the desired direction to flip through
content in the active window like pages in a book.
Flick also works vertically when navigating content such as
images or songs in a playlist
Rotate Rotate clockwiseKeeping a finger or thumb in place, move
the other finger in an arched direction to the right.
Rotate counter-clockwiseKeeping a finger or thumb in
place, move the other finger in an arched direction to the left.
You can also rotate the active content by moving both the
fingers in a circular motion.
Scroll PanMove the focus on the selected object when the entire
object is not visible.
Move two fingers in the desired direction to pan the selected
object.
